PowerPoint presented by Fernando Neri, Bolivia, at the First Workshop on the System of Rice Intensification (SRI) in Latin America at EARTH University in Costa Rica, Oct. 31-Nov. 1, 2011

Large expanses of land under water for several months, no crops left

Rainwater drains off taking out the nutrients with it, leaving a sandy soil in which it is hard to grow crops

Crops like rice, maize, cassava, banana, onions, and others

System of Rice Intensification(SRI)

• Methodology to Methodology to increase productivity of rice from increase productivity of rice from a change in the management of plants, soil, a change in the management of plants, soil, water, and nutrients.*water, and nutrients.*

• SRIs practices help SRIs practices help soil to be healthier and more soil to be healthier and more productive, productive, and plants to have and plants to have a higher root a higher root growth by promoting the abundance and growth by promoting the abundance and diversity of soil organisms.*diversity of soil organisms.*
